Sesame introduced the Conversational Speech Model (CSM), a multimodal text and speech model that uses two autoregressive transformers. Key contributions include a single-stage architecture and an evaluation suite for contextual capabilities.

## Evidence

Verbatim from https://www.sesame.com/blog/crossing-the-uncanny-valley-of-voice:

> we introduce the Conversational Speech Model (CSM), which frames the problem as an end-to-end multimodal learning task using transformers. It leverages the history of the conversation to produce more natural and coherent speech. There are two key takeaways from our work. The first is that CSM operates as a single-stage model , thereby improving efficiency and expressivity. The second is our evaluation suite , which is necessary for evaluating progress on contextual capabilities
